Provide technical support in a medical device complaint investigation lab by analyzing returned products, interpreting findings, and supporting quality initiatives across multiple functional teams.
Job Requirements:
Associate Degree or equivalent related work experience
Proficient in Microsoft Office tools (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ook)
Ability to read, understand, and communicate procedural requirements
Ability to work independently under limited supervision or within a team
Preferred Skills:
Associate Degree in a technical discipline
Experience with electrical and mechanical equipment
1 year of quality or manufacturing experience in the medical device industry
Ability to identify process improvement opportunities
Job Responsibilities:
Assist engineering with quality support by analyzing data and identifying complaint trends
Perform device analysis on returned medical devices to determine likely malfunction causes
Review device history records, product labeling, and risk documentation
Prioritize tasks to meet deadlines and quality system metrics
Interpret test results and identify unusual characteristics during analysis
Write investigation reports summarizing findings and conclusions
Troubleshoot compromised procedures to identify root causes
Communicate testing schedules, results, and discoveries with technical staff and customers
Analyze, review, and document lab records for proper archiving
Manage test requests from initiation through filing and archiving processes
